Cost Considerations

When planning your ride from Sabiha Gökçen Airport, understanding is crucial. You wouldn’t want to be caught off guard by unexpected expenses, right? Let’s break it down.

First off, let’s talk about the main transportation options available:

  • Buses: These are usually the most economical choice. A bus ride to central Istanbul can cost around 30-40 Turkish Lira. It’s a great way to save money if you’re not in a hurry.
  • Taxis: Taking a taxi offers convenience but comes at a higher price. Expect to pay between 250-300 Turkish Lira for a ride to the city center. And remember, there might be additional charges for luggage or late-night rides.
  • Private Shuttles: These can range from 200-400 Turkish Lira, depending on the service provider and your destination. It’s a comfortable option, especially if you’re traveling with a group.

Now, here’s a little tip: always confirm the fare before you hop in. Taxis often have meters, but some drivers might quote you a higher price. It’s best to have a rough idea of what you should be paying.

Another thing to consider is the hidden costs. For instance, if you’re using a shuttle service, check if they include taxes or fees in the quoted price. Sometimes, what looks like a good deal can turn out to be more expensive once you factor in all the extras.
